Adani Green Energy Limited (ADANIGREEN) — Strategic Asset Allocation Index
Adani Green Energy Limited (ADANIGREEN) has a Strategic Asset Allocation Index of 361.0% as of September 2025. Strategic assets (PP&E of Rs1.05 Trillion plus long-term investments of Rs-) total Rs1.05 Trillion, measured against net assets of Rs290.84 Billion. A higher index reflects capital-intensive or investment-heavy strategies where strategic assets dominate the equity base. Annual Strategic Asset Allocation Index for Adani Green Energy Limited (2016–2025)
The table below presents the year-by-year Strategic Asset Allocation Index for Adani Green Energy Limited from 2016 to 2025, covering 10 annual filings. Each row shows PP&E, long-term investments, strategic assets combined, net assets, the index percentage, and the change in percentage points compared to the prior year. | Year | SAAI | Strategic Assets (INR) | PP&E | LT Investments | Net Assets | Change (pp) |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2025 | 417.8% | Rs943.02 Billion | Rs943.02 Billion | Rs- | Rs225.73 Billion | ▲ +24.5 pp |
| 2024 | 393.3% | Rs686.18 Billion | Rs686.18 Billion | Rs- | Rs174.48 Billion | ▼ -335.3 pp |
| 2023 | 728.5% | Rs535.48 Billion | Rs535.48 Billion | Rs- | Rs73.50 Billion | ▼ -1118.0 pp |
| 2022 | 1846.5% | Rs482.68 Billion | Rs482.68 Billion | Rs- | Rs26.14 Billion | ▲ +868.2 pp |
| 2021 | 978.4% | Rs208.00 Billion | Rs208.00 Billion | Rs- | Rs21.26 Billion | ▲ +383.0 pp |
| 2020 | 595.4% | Rs137.57 Billion | Rs137.57 Billion | Rs- | Rs23.11 Billion | ▲ +17.6 pp |
| 2019 | 577.8% | Rs111.64 Billion | Rs111.27 Billion | Rs367.20 Million | Rs19.32 Billion | ▼ -299.7 pp |
| 2018 | 877.5% | Rs108.86 Billion | Rs108.44 Billion | Rs417.56 Million | Rs12.41 Billion | ▲ +494.5 pp |
| 2017 | 383.0% | Rs46.07 Billion | Rs46.07 Billion | Rs- | Rs12.03 Billion | ▼ -3210.0 pp |
| 2016 | 3593.0% | Rs48.86 Billion | Rs47.24 Billion | Rs1.62 Billion | Rs1.36 Billion | — |
